Cumberland County Schools announce make-up days

Students will have to make up the two days they missed due to a winter storm that dumped 4 inches of snow in Fayetteville.

FAYETTEVILLE, N.C. — Cumberland County school officials have announced that students will be in classes two extra – but shortened – days to make up for this week’s winter storm closings.

Students will now have to go to school on two days they were supposed to have off, but they will get out two hours early.

Traditional calendar students will make up the days on Feb. 16 and April 10.

Students on the year-round calendar will make up the missed time on Feb. 16 and April 17.

There will be two-hour early releases on the make-up days for both traditional and year-round students.
